這個是我初學python寫的部落格 第一次寫部落格為了讓自己記憶深刻一些。
目的很單純:我是為了學習人工智慧才來學習python的python就是一種物件導向的一種語言(高階語言)python一切皆物件
注釋:python的注釋分為兩種
單行注釋#
多行注釋可以用多個"""注釋內容"""
號,還有''' 注釋內容 "'
行與縮排:
這個是python與其他語言不一樣的地方,python是通過縮排是否一致
來判斷是不是同一**塊(一般縮排都是佔四個空格
)例如:
識別符號和關鍵字:
識別符號第乙個字元只能
是字母或者下劃線_
剩下的字元可以是字母,數字
,下劃線_
區分大小寫
python關鍵字:
and 用於計算的表示與
not 用於計算的表示非
or 用於計算的表示或
as 用於型別轉換
break 用於中斷迴圈
continue中斷
本次迴圈,繼續執行
下一次迴圈
class 用於表示類
def 用於定義
函式或者方法
del刪除
變數或者序列的值
第一種for迴圈
語句
第二種while迴圈
語句
if elif else條件
語句
try except finally 用來查詢異常
from 用於匯入模組
和import結合使用
in 判斷是否在
序列中
is 判斷是否為
某個類中的例項
global 定義全域性變數
nonlocal 定義區域性變數
pass 是空的
函式,方法,類的佔位符
raise 異常之後應該幹什麼
return返回結果
變數:python中變數不需要宣告型別,因為python語言是動態
的
python變數就是乙個物件
,包括(id,type,value) id就是變數它的記憶體位址
,type就是變數的型別
,value就是變數的值
例如:
變數的賦值:x=13就是把13給x
也支援多個值乙個賦值a,b=3,4
輸入與輸出:
python你和計算機交流
就是通過輸入
,計算機給你發話
的就是輸出
實現輸入就得用的python的內建函式input() 返回的值是字串
例如:
輸出用到print(value,sep=『』,end=『\n』)
value就是輸出的值 sep就是多個值中分割的 預設是空格分隔 end是值之後新增的符合 預設是換行符 例如:
C語言入門第一章
什麼是演算法?什麼是流程圖?程圖是演算法的一種圖形化表示方式,流程圖使用一組預定義的符號來說明如何執行特定任務 c語言簡介 c語言的開發工具 codeblocks安裝配置 c語言的基本結構 include void main main 函式是c程式處理的起點 入口main 函式可以返回乙個值,也可以...
python入門第一章之資料型別
python的基本資料型別包括以下幾種 整數浮點數 字串布林值 空值1 整數 python支援像數學中一樣表示的整數,包括正整數和負整數,例如 0,100,999等。因為計算機使用的是二進位制,所以很多時候用十六進製制表示整數 比較方便,十六進製製用0x字首和0 9 a f表示,例如 0x0a0b等...
第一章 入門
第一章 入門。1.linux應用程式表現為2種特殊型別的檔案 可執行檔案和指令碼檔案,對應windows下的。exe和批處理。linux不要求可執行檔案或指令碼有特殊的餓副檔名,檔案系統屬性用來表明乙個檔案是否為可執行程式。2.我們是與乙個叫bash的指令碼進行互動的,指令碼裡可執行檔案的執行要麼在...